Record number: 1, Textual support number: 1 OBS
In 1882, the Ontario government established the Bureau of Industry under the Department of Agriculture. In 1900, a Bureau of Labour came into being, and labour affairs were transferred from the Department of Agriculture to Public Works. The bureau was replaced in 1916 by Trades and labour Branch, still under Public Works. In April 1919, Bill 169 brought all labour matters under the new Department of Labour. It was renamed the Ministry of Labour in 1970, when the Department of Labour Act was repealed and replaced by the Ministry of Labour Act 1, record 1, English, - Ministry%20of%20Labour

Record number: 2, Textual support number: 1 OBS
Social policy researchers, consultants and program officers conduct research, develop policy and implement or administer programs in areas such as consumer affairs, employment, home economics, immigration, law enforcement, corrections, human rights, housing, labour, family services, foreign aid and international development. They are employed by government departments and agencies, industry, hospitals, educational institutions, consulting establishments, professional associations, research institutes, non-government organizations and international organizations or they may be self-employed. 1, record 2, English, - Social%20policy%20researchers%2C%20consultants%20and%20program%20officers

Record number: 3, Textual support number: 1 OBS
The International Business Opportunities Centre(IBOC) provides a matching service-connecting foreign buyers with Canadian companies. The Centre works in partnership with Canada's trade officers who are located around the world in Canada's embassies and consulates. When one of Canada's trade officers identifies a business opportunity, they turn to the International Business Opportunities Centre for help. The team of specialists at the Centre immediately goes to work to search out and contact potential Canadian exporters. IBOC is the export opportunities sourcing centre for Team Canada Inc, a partnership of government departments and agencies working together to provide trade services to Canadian exporters. The Centre is managed jointly by the Department of Foreign Affairs and International Trade and Industry Canada. The Centre has a partnership agreement with Agriculture and Agri-Food Canada. 2, record 3, English, - International%20Business%20Opportunities%20Centre

Record number: 4, Textual support number: 1 OBS
The mandate of the Office of Northern Affairs is to promote the social and economic development of northern Saskatchewan communities in partnership with the federal government and northern communities by supporting regional, business and industry development, and co-ordinating government activities in the Northern Administration District(NAD) of Saskatchewan. 1, record 4, English, - Office%20of%20Northern%20Affairs

Record number: 5, Textual support number: 1 OBS
The Motorcycle & Moped Industry Council, originally founded in 1971, is a national, non-profit, trade association which represents the responsible interests of the major motorcycle and scooter distributors, as well as the manufacturers, distributors and retail outlets of motorcycle and scooter related products and services, and individual owners and riders of motorcycles and scooters in Canada. Council' s aims and objectives : to promote the safe and responsible use of motorcycles and scooters; to develop and expand communication and cooperation among all levels of the motorcycle and scooter community; to enhance government relations and public affairs through broad cooperative efforts; to promote the responsible interests of motorcycle and scooter riders and the industry. 4, record 5, English, - Motorcycle%20%26%20Moped%20Industry%20Council

Record number: 6, Textual support number: 1 OBS
With the establishment of the new Science, Technology and Innovation Council(STIC), the roles and responsibilities of a number of federal advisory bodies, including the Office of the National Science Advisor(ONSA), were reviewed. In this context, the Office will be phased out, the position of National Science Advisor will be discontinued, and the STIC will function as a single external committee, providing the government with independent and integrated advice on science and technology. The Science and Innovation Sector of Industry Canada and the Department of Foreign Affairs and International Trade will assume programmatic activities of the ONSA. 1, record 6, English, - National%20Science%20Advisor%20to%20the%20Government%20of%20Canada

Record number: 8, Textual support number: 1 OBS
Japan's Ministry of International Trade and Industry(MITI) was formed in 1949 from the union of the Trade Agency and the Ministry of Commerce and Industry in an effort to curb postwar inflation and provide government leadership and assistance for the restoration of industrial productivity and employment. MITI has held primary responsibility for formulating and implementing international trade policy, although it has done so by seeking a consensus among interested parties, including the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and the Ministry of Finance. 2, record 8, English, - Ministry%20of%20International%20Trade%20and%20Industry

Record number: 9, Textual support number: 1 OBS
Investment Partnerships Canada was established in 1996 as part of the federal investment strategy designed to attract Foreign Direct Investment(FDI) to Canada, particularly from Multinational Enterprises(MNEs). Investment Partnerships Canada(IPC) works to coordinate the federal government's investment strategy, also working closely with the provinces, territories and major municipalities. In creating an investment partnership between Industry Canada and Department of Foreign Affairs and International Trade(DFAIT), IPC is unique in the government in that it reports equally to two Deputy Ministers(DMs) and two Ministers from two different departments. 3, record 9, English, - Investment%20Partnerships%20Canada
